Step 2: Claiming the Bonus
Most casinos offer welcome bonuses to new players. Here’s how to make the most of it:
- Check the bonus terms and conditions.
- Look for bonuses with low wagering requirements, ideally around 35x.
- Claim the bonus when prompted during registration or through the promotions page.
Understanding the bonus structure is essential; for example, if you receive a £100 bonus with a 35x wagering requirement, you must wager £3,500 before you can withdraw any winnings.

Step 4: Understanding the Rules
Before jumping into a game, familiarize yourself with the rules of your chosen variant:
- Learn hand rankings, from high card to royal flush.
- Understand betting rounds and actions (fold, call, raise).
- Practice with free play options to build confidence.
Step 5: Managing Your Bankroll
Effective bankroll management is key to long-term success. Follow these tips:
- Set a budget for each session.
- Stick to a fixed limit for each game.
- Avoid chasing losses; accept that losses are part of the game.
Step 6: Playing the Game
When you’re ready to play, keep these strategies in mind:
- Pay attention to your opponents’ betting patterns.
- Be aware of your position at the table; early positions require tighter play.
- Use bluffing strategically; don’t overdo it.
